"AccessDenied"(访问被拒绝)是一个常见的错误信息,通常出现在计算机系统、网络、应用程序或云服务的权限管理中。它表示某个用户或进程试图访问资源时,由于权限不足而被系统拒绝。这是安全机制的一部分,用于防止未经授权的访问。
类型
文件系统访问拒绝 :用户尝试读取或写入文件时被拒绝。网络访问拒绝:
尝试连接到某个网络资源或服务时被拒绝。
应用程序权限拒绝:
在软件应用中执行特定功能时被拒绝。
数据库访问拒绝:
查询或修改数据库时被拒绝。
策略限制:
安全策略或防火墙规则阻止了访问。
资源不存在:
尝试访问的资源可能已被移除或重命名。
可能的原因和解决方法
MySQL服务器未启动
重启MySQL服务器:`systemctl restart mysqld`。
用户端口号或IP不匹配
编辑`my.ini`文件,将端口号或IP更改为正确的值。
配置文件错误
替换错误的`my.ini`文件。
root用户密码错误
修改root用户密码:`mysql –uroot –p`,然后输入新密码。
Git凭据问题
在控制面板 -> 用户帐号 -> 凭据管理器 -> windows凭据 -> 普通凭据中编辑或更新Git地址的凭据。
权限不足
以管理员身份运行命令提示符或CMD。
Linux系统默认禁止远程登录
编辑`/etc/ssh/sshd_config`文件,将`PermitRootLogin`设置为`yes`,然后重启SSH服务:`systemctl restart sshd`。
根据具体情况,可以尝试上述方法来解决"AccessDenied"错误。如果问题仍然存在,可能需要进一步检查系统日志或联系系统管理员以获取帮助。
声明:
本站内容均来自网络,如有侵权,请联系我们。